5-Day Family-Friendly Itinerary in Delhi

Viewed by 59 travelers
Tuesday, November 14: Exploring Old Delhi

In the morning, start your trip by visiting the historic Red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age site. Explore its magnificent architecture and learn about its rich history. For lunch, head to Karim's, a famous restaurant known for its delicious Mughlai cuisine. In the afternoon, take a rickshaw ride through the bustling streets of Chandni Chowk, one of the oldest and busiest markets in Delhi. As the evening approaches, visit Jama Masjid, the largest mosque in India, and admire its grandeur.

  • Red Fort: Estimated cost - INR 250 per person,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• Karim's: Estimated cost - INR 500 per person, Estimated time spent - 1 hour
  • Rickshaw ride in Chandni Chowk: Estimated cost - INR 200 per person, Estimated time spent - 1.5 hours
  • Jama Masjid: Free entry, Estimated time spent - 1 hour
Wednesday, November 15: Educational Fun at Museums

Start your day with a visit to the National Museum, the largest museum in India, offering a diverse collection of art and artifacts. For a unique experience, head to the National Rail Museum to learn about the history of Indian railways. In the afternoon, visit the National Science Centre, a great place for interactive exhibits and educational activities. As the evening sets in, explore Lodhi Gardens, a peaceful green oasis in the heart of the city.

  • National Museum: Estimated cost - INR 20 per person, Estimated time spent - 3 hours
  • National Rail Museum: Estimated cost - INR 100 per person,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• National Science Centre: Estimated cost - INR 50 per person,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• Lodhi Gardens: Free entry, Estimated time spent - 1.5 hours
Thursday, November 16: Fun-filled Day at Amusement Parks

Spend the morning at Worlds of Wonder, a popular amusement park with thrilling rides and water attractions. Enjoy the various entertainment options and indulge in delicious snacks. In the afternoon, visit Adventure Island, another exciting amusement park with a variety of rides and activities suitable for the whole family. Wrap up the day with a relaxing boat ride at Surajkund Lake, located near Adventure Island.

  • Worlds of Wonder: Estimated cost - INR 1000 per person, Estimated time spent - 4 hours
  • Adventure Island: Estimated cost - INR 800 per person, Estimated time spent - 3 hours
  • Boat ride at Surajkund Lake: Estimated cost - INR 200 per person, Estimated time spent - 1.5 hours
Friday, November 17: Cultural Exploration and Shopping

Start your day with a visit to the impressive Akshardham Temple, known for its stunning architecture and cultural exhibits. Spend the afternoon at Dilli Haat, a vibrant open-air shopping plaza where you can find traditional crafts, textiles, and delicious street food. In the evening, explore Hauz Khas Village, a trendy neighborhood filled with cafes, boutiques, and art galleries.

  • Akshardham Temple: Free entry,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• Dilli Haat: Estimated cost - INR 100 per person,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• Hauz Khas Village: Free entry,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
Saturday, November 18: Wildlife Adventure at Delhi Zoo

On your last day, spend a leisurely morning exploring the Delhi Zoo, home to a wide variety of animals and birds. Enjoy a walk through the park and take time to observe the wildlife. In the afternoon, visit the nearby National Handicrafts and Handlooms Museum to learn about traditional Indian crafts. End your trip with a visit to India Gate, an iconic monument and gathering place in Delhi, and take in its majestic surroundings.

  • Delhi Zoo: Estimated cost - INR 40 per person, Estimated time spent - 3 hours
  • National Handicrafts and Handlooms Museum: Estimated cost - INR 20 per person,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• India Gate: Free entry, Estimated time spent - 1 hour

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For a unique off the beaten path experience, consider visiting Mehrauli Archaeological Park. It is a serene and lesser-known archaeological complex where you can explore ancient ruins, tombs, and monuments while enjoying a peaceful atmosphere. Another local favorite is Stroll along the Rajpath near India Gate in the evening to experience the vibrant street food scene. Indulge in popular snacks like chaat, golgappe, and kulfi while enjoying the lively ambiance.
